The meeting is located on the west side of Santo Amaro Dock (Doca de Santo Amaro), GATE 1 (click for 360 view). This is just bellow to the large red suspension bridge across Tagus river, the 25th April bridge. There is no mark or shop on the place as it’s not allowed to place advertisement in the area.

Follow in the bottom of the page, or place these coordinates on google maps: 38.69912, -9.17882

How to get here:

UBER or Taxi

This is the easiest way, but count with traffic time in weekdays. The meeting point has no drop off, you have to walk from the drop off point to the meeting point.

This is the drop off point: 38.70046, -9.17521

360 view of the drop off point

Search for Lisbon Dolphins on the apps

Pay attention where the driver is taking you, most drivers  don’t know the city and follow blindly the app. If you are in Lisbon, DO NOT cross the bridge for some reason ubers tend to drive to the other side. DO NOT leave at Alcântara dock, for some reason ubers tend to drop you at Alcântara dock, which is the neighbouring dock and is 15 min away by walk, make them go all the way to the drop off point.

Self driving

Car drivers have free car parking, 7 minute walk away from the meeting point. Or at 1 minute walk away paid car parking.

Public transportation

This is the cheapest way. Depending where you are, the route can take many forms.

From city centre or east side usually ends up going to Cais do Sodré (usually by green line metro/subway) and from there you have plenty of options:

  • SHARED Bikes and scooters are the best option for door to door, but you need basic navigation skills. Follow the bike road all the way to the the second dock, and when you arrive to under the bridge you’ll find a large parking zone for these scooters and ebikes. If you end up with the bridge on your back, you’re in the wrong way!

From west side, the train (Cascais Line) usually is the best way. Exit on Alcântara-Mar station, go for the south/riverside exit. At arrival to the docks, head west towards the bridge, meeting point will be close to the last building and just under the bridge.

What’s Available

  • Coffee place only 5 meters away from the meeting point, usually open at 9am.
  • Restroom/WC is on the coffee place, you need to buy something like a coffee or water in order to use it. Also you need to go all at the same time, as after you return the card they will not give it to you again.
  • Restaurants after the experience there is a good amount of places for lunch.

Final considerations

  • Bring warm clothes, like a jacket, a hoodie is the bare minimum, as a sweater will fall short. Even if it’s +30ºC on land! Think that you’re going on an chairlift to the top of a 2000m high mountain in summer (1000m in winter). Read our bad reviews, it’s all about the cold!
  • Plan your trip to arrive 15 min EARLIER of the scheduled departure time. Excuses like “so much traffic” or “no ubers available” are getting too old! We must depart on time, many times wind is already picking up and we’ve also lost stars on reviews, due to making guests wait.
  • Avoid drinking too much before the expedition as there is no toilet on the boat.
  • Sunscreen, even if is a cloudy/foggy day, from Spring to Autumn the sun burns
  • You can bring some snacks.
